Someone special may be buying me a serger for my birthday - do you have any recommendations? I don't know a thing about them so I don't know what's good, bad or indifferent.

I've looked at Sears already (my machine is from there, I like their warranty/service plans) but their options were limited.

I don't know much about sergers but you may want to visit Marie's Sewing Center in the Wouburn Mall (next to Fabric Place). I purchased my regular Elna machine there and would really recommend them. They spent a lot of time with me and let me play around, even though the purchase price I would be spending was low relative to many of the machines they carry (you have to check out the computer-controlled embroidery machines!). Extremely helpful in helping me find the best machine fit for my needs, since up 'til then I'd never used more than straight/zigzag.

This wouldn't be the place to find a cheap machine, as they carry some high end brands (Baby Lock, Pfaff, Elna) but I was really impressed with the service. My machine came with a 30(!) year warranty from the manufacturer, and the shop offers a one-year trade-in plan -- you can trade in your machine for a more expensive one within a year, and the trade-in value is equal to whatever you paid. You also get one free class with purchase.
